A friend is trying to track down a book, and based on her description, I also want to read it. There are two characters on a salvage ship traveling in space with a cat. Main protagonist may be female or gender-fluid. They find sentient nanobots that are dangerous. Ships are also sentient, and move through space by generating a large field. There may be a sentient tree that acts as a judge. Book may be part of a series.

>1 SusanBraxton: I wonder if your friend might be talking about the Sharon Lee and Steve Miller Liaden books, which do have a sentient tree (though I don't remember it being a judge) and sentient ships and cats. In The Gathering Edge two pilots and a cat are rescued by a sentient ship and its crew.

If this isn't the book/series your friend is looking for, it still might be a series that the two of you would like.

I have heard from my friend that she has found the book she was seeking. It was one of the two books from Elizabeth Bear’s White Space series (either Ancestral Night or Machine ).
